Disused tower blocks and old student accommodation in towns and cities may being converted into migrant housing, sparking fresh alarm among local communities. Opponents of the move, confirmed by Government ministers amid rising immigration pressures, claim it risks worsening strains on public services and damaging treasured urban environments.
The repurposing of these ageing residential buildings has become a key part of the Government’s short-term asylum accommodation strategy, but critics say it is a stopgap measure with serious consequences. Dame Angela Eagle, Minister of State for Border Security and Asylum, defended the policy during her appearance before the Home Affairs Committee on Tuesday. She said repurposing vacant residential buildings – including ageing tower blocks in university towns – was a necessary response to mounting pressure on the asylum system and soaring accommodation costs.

She stressed: “We have a responsibility to offer safety to those fleeing persecution and hardship. But that responsibility must be met without sacrificing the wellbeing of our students, our historic cities, and the communities that call them home.”
Her comments come amid growing concern over the backlog in the asylum system, which has surged due to record numbers of small boat crossings and other arrivals.
The Home Office faces mounting pressure to find affordable accommodation for tens of thousands of asylum seekers currently housed in hotels or temporary facilities.

These views echo broader tensions in university towns grappling with student housing shortages.
Some local councils say they are being kept in the dark about which buildings are being converted and warn that a sudden influx of residents could overwhelm schools, GP practices, and public transport.
Council leaders express particular concern over the lack of transparency and planning in the roll-out of this policy. Many say they were not consulted before decisions were made, leaving them scrambling to manage the impact on already stretched local services.

Heritage groups further warn that converting listed or historic buildings without careful planning risks irreversible damage to conservation areas, undermining the character of cherished city centres. Several conservationists have expressed alarm that rushed conversions could lead to the loss of architectural features and strain on fragile urban infrastructure.
A Home Office spokesperson described the policy as “pragmatic and cost-effective,” arguing that repurposing empty buildings is a short-term measure while permanent asylum infrastructure is developed. They insisted ministers are aware of local concerns and said efforts are underway to engage more closely with councils.

Separately, Chancellor Rachel Reeves has committed to ending the use of hotels to house asylum seekers during this Parliament.
Unveiling her spending review in the Commons on Wednesday, Ms Reeves set out how funding will be provided to cut the asylum backlog and save taxpayers billions of pounds.
A total £200 million of transformation funding will be used to speed up the overhaul of the asylum system, documents show.
